I double the cables over until they're short enough, and then tie them into a loose half knot.

No fasteners to wish for, or to fail.

Both ends of every cable are always next to each other for identification at a glance.

Different cables cannot tangle with each other in a box.

There are no axial twists imparted into the cable.

(Stage hands hate this technique, but this isn't stagecraft.)

It works best with short-ish cables; several meters or less is nice and quick and is simple to keep neat.

Longer cables can also work but it kind of takes more space to get it done. Like, a 30-meter extension cord or similar is completely do-able, but it's useful to be able to walk around while it is happening. If the cable is both very long and very heavy, then it's a great workout for all kinds of muscle groups that may have been forgotten about. :)

But again, it's quick for the lengths we usually use in PC and home AV spaces. Or at least becomes quick with enough repetition: My hands seem to know how to do it on their own without me really looking or even thinking about it, and that frees my other resources up enough that I can visually plan my next (unrelated) move while the first is still in motion.

Multiple cables of about the same length can be wrapped together like this. A stereo pair of RCA interconnects, or the same 3 cables that always get used with a laptop, can stay grouped together and never become separated in storage.

It also works on laptop cables with a power brick in the middle.

And it's nice to the cables. Inherently avoiding axial twists is key here and the process also tends to help remove minor twists that showed up while the cable was in-use. It does produce periodic bends, and those bends always happen at the same places, and that repeated deformation does promote stress fractures at very predictable places.

But cables generally survive thousands of iterations of this over the span of decades, and decades is good enough. :)

Stage hands, meanwhile: There's reasons they hate the double-double technique, above. Their cables can be very long, there can be literal tons of them, and speed is a very important factor.

So they use a very specific coiling technique called over-under that seems impossible to describe with written language alone. It does put axial twist into the cable but those twists alternate and average to 0 instead of accumulating or multiplying (like elbow-wrapping can do[1]).

Over-under always requires the coil and cable ends to be tied up together before storage. That's often accomplished with an appropriate length of stout string or even rope that is permanently tied to one end (nothing to lose), but velcro can work too.

It's a solid technique. When done right, it allows fast deployment: Untie it, hang onto one end, and the rest can be literally thrown across a stage or whatever. Since the twist averages to 0, it tends to unwind neatly as it flies and lay flat when it lands.

And, of course: It stows well. Cables wrapped over-under can be tossed into a bag or a trunk or hung on hooks or whatever; they don't tangle.

It's probably overkill for the big box of mostly-short cables at home, but it's also worth understanding for the longer stuff we also use.

[1]: Elbow-wrapping and other very common methods that aren't unwrapped exactly oppositely of how they were wrapped up to begin with, or provide some other mechanism to manage twist: Those are great ways to put permanent axial twists into a cable. It is the entire reason why the long extension cords hanging in so many home garages and work environments alike (and especially on commercial vacuum cleaners[2]) wind up looking like coil springs or curly pasta even after being stretched out flat-ish in an open space. They didn't start off that way; they were forced to be that way through handling. Friends don't let friends elbow-wrap cables.

[2]: And that's also why residential vacuum cleaners usually have a large number of ridges running down the length of their power cords.

The usual storage method has the user winding the cable around hooks on the side of the machine, and the usual deployment method involves rotating one of those hooks and liberating the entire coil of cable at once. This tends to promote axial twist.

But! The ridges enhance rotational friction. So as the ridged cable slides through the user's hand as they wind it back up onto the side of the machine after use, the ridges help those twists to be pushed down the line to the far end where the plug is. And since that end is loose at that time, it's free to rotate and alleviate twist. This happens automatically as the user winds up the cable and is a pretty good design trick. :) (I have no idea why commercial machines use smooth cable.)
